You will always have something to do, go to restaurants, movies, join a gym and sporting activities, play golf, as well as fishing and camping and activities at the lake.The Role This permanent, fulltime position will require you to work on site in the main workshop within the fitting team. You will be responsible for carrying out all aspects of general machining using Lathes, Borers, Line boring equipment and milling machines. You will also help the fitting team to carry out rebuilds of wide variety of fixed plant equipment from gearboxes, pumps, conveyor drums to vent Fans in a large workshop environment. This is a residential role in Mount Isa, working a 48-hour week 4/3 or a 56- hour week 5/2 roster.The successful candidate will be responsible for:
Reclaiming bores on earth moving equipment and fixed plant equipment
Producing work to specific manufacturing standards, sizes and finishes
Working as part of the line boring team when needed
Strip, measure, inspect and report on all components.
Attending to jobs both on customer premises and in the workshop
General machining which will include the use of lathes, Large Horizontal borers and milling machines.
Correctly interpret and apply engineering drawings, measuring equipment and company documentation
Complete assigned work and associated paperwork to a high standard with the relevant notes regarding any repairs.
Ensuring safe work behaviours for yourself and your fellow team members
Effective time management
